Collision Avoidance: By analyzing data from various sources, ADAS can predict and prevent potential collisions.
Lane Departure Warning: Sensors detect lane markings and alert drivers if they unintentionally drift from their lane.
Traffic Sign Recognition: Cameras read traffic signs and notify drivers of speed limits and other important information.

Key ADAS Features and Their Functions
ADAS encompasses a wide array of technologies designed to prevent accidents and make driving easier. Adaptive cruise control, for example, maintains a set distance from the vehicle ahead, adjusting speed as necessary. Lane keeping assist helps drivers stay in their lane, gently steering the car back if it begins to drift. Each feature, from blind spot detection to traffic sign recognition, plays a crucial role in enhancing safety and convenience.
